stuny Posted March 21, 2007 Share #2 Â Posted March 21, 2007 Tommy - Â The C-Lux-1 (and the Panasonic FX-01) had 6.0 megapixels. The C-Lux-2 (and the Panasonic FX-07) has 7.2 megapixels, and the ability to greatly brighten the LCD when shooting or reviewing in sunlight. I believe that they use the same sensor and processing engine, thought the C-Lux-1 MIGJHT be balanced a bit differently.
